Wrestling legend Vader OK after near-fatal car accident
Big Van Vader/Twitter
Former WCW and WWE star Vader was involved in a near-fatal car accident Tuesday in Boulder, Colo. Fortunately, it looks like he only suffered a few scrapes and bruises.
The 61-year-old, whose real name is Leon Allen White, wrote on Twitter that he was knocked unconscious and temporarily trapped inside the car while it was flipped over, describing the accident as a "close one."
